Alex DeBrincat scored the go-ahead goal with 3:25 remaining and assisted on Detroit’s two other goals, lifting the Red Wings to a 3-1 victory over the Montreal Canadiens on Thursday night. DeBrincat scored the winner on a backhander after stealing the puck from defenseman Mike Matheson in the Canadiens’ zone. J.T. Compher scored earlier in the period and Andrew Copp added an empty-net goal with 16.8 seconds remaining.
